Microstrategy accumulation Play⁤ and ‌Its Impact on Bitcoin Liquidity ⁢and Price⁢ Discovery

Microstrategy’s‍ ongoing acquisition campaign has reshaped ‍where and⁤ how price⁤ formation occurs ⁣in the⁤ bitcoin market. By consistently sourcing large ⁢blocks outside spot exchanges-often via negotiated OTC trades⁣ and⁢ convertible instruments-the​ company ⁣has drawn a ‌meaningful portion of ‌available⁢ long-term supply out of​ visible order books.Market makers and high-frequency ⁤liquidity providers now contend‍ with thinner displayed ⁢depth, and short-term price adjustments ⁢increasingly reflect the cadence‍ of institutional ⁢buys as much as​ retail flows.

The firm’s behavior has‍ triggered​ a ​cascade of​ market responses that extend beyond simple supply ‍absorption. Key channels‌ include:

  • Institutional signaling – ⁣repeated accumulation normalizes corporate treasury ‌bitcoin holdings and invites peer ⁢firms ⁤to‍ reassess allocations;
  • OTC concentration – ‌large off-exchange deals reduce on-exchange depth, ‌affecting spreads and execution ‌costs;
  • Derivatives feedback – futures‌ and options markets price in ‌the asymmetric demand, changing ⁣basis and implied volatility dynamics;
  • On-chain effects ⁣- prolonged hodling translates ​into‍ lower⁢ circulating supply metrics, used ⁣by⁤ traders⁣ and analysts for valuation models.

Each channel tightens the link ‌between⁣ discrete corporate decisions⁢ and broader market‌ microstructure.

The net ‍result for price discovery is​ a ⁢market where basic ⁤corporate demand is a measurable driver of⁣ short- and ⁢medium-term price ⁢signals. Exchanges may show wider bid-ask spreads ⁢during⁢ accumulation phases,while off-exchange flows compress realized volatility⁢ when executed ⁣steadily‌ and expand ⁤it ⁤when concentrated. For investors⁢ and policymakers alike, the‍ key takeaway is that ⁢concentrated, public corporate strategies can materially alter liquidity profiles‌ and the data content of prices-transforming what was onc ⁤primarily ‍a ​retail-driven price discovery ​process into one increasingly influenced by institutional balance-sheet ⁤dynamics.

Corporate Treasury Bitcoin ​Reserves Redefine Market Sentiment and Institutional Adoption

Corporate Treasury Bitcoin Reserves redefine⁤ Market Sentiment and Institutional Adoption

Microstrategy’s aggressive accumulation has etched​ a new playbook ‌for‌ corporate⁢ treasurers: allocate not⁤ just for⁤ yield or liquidity but⁢ for ⁣asymmetric exposure. ⁢Markets‌ reacted‌ not only to the size of its⁢ purchases but to the signaling ‍effect-a public firm treating bitcoin‌ as ‌a​ strategic reserve⁣ alters price discovery and ​investor expectations. ⁢Traders and⁣ CIOs now price in⁣ the possibility that⁤ corporate bids could underpin demand​ during ‍liquidity⁢ squeezes,shifting‍ short-term ⁢sentiment and ⁣lengthening the​ investment horizon for ⁤digital assets.

Boards and finance ⁢teams are reassessing‍ policy frameworks as the⁢ once-fringe idea ​of balance-sheet ​crypto ownership migrates⁢ to the mainstream. Key⁢ operational changes ⁣taking root ⁤include:

  • revised diversification ​rules ⁢ that permit ‍a ⁤defined ⁣allocation‌ to digital ‌assets;
  • New ⁤custody and counterparty protocols to manage operational and⁤ custodial​ risk;
  • Liquidity contingency ​planning ⁢ for using crypto ‌positions in stress scenarios.

These moves reflect​ a tangible⁢ increase in corporate risk⁢ tolerance and‌ a willingness⁢ to embrace strategic‌ innovation⁤ as part of⁤ treasury ⁢management.

Risk management Lessons ⁢from ⁤Microstrategy⁤ Including Capital Structure,⁤ Volatility‌ Controls ‌and Disclosure best‌ Practices

Capital allocation choices ‍at ⁢a corporate scale transform balance sheets into market signals. Microstrategy’s use⁣ of ‍debt ​and ⁢equity to ‍accumulate bitcoin illustrates how capital structure becomes‌ a⁣ primary risk-management tool: leverage amplifies returns but⁢ also magnifies operational and covenant risk for a software company turned ⁢corporate‌ treasurer.Boards and CFOs must ⁣therefore⁣ treat strategic crypto exposure like any major ⁢M&A‍ or treasury‌ shift-embed stress tests, maintain clear ⁣liquidity buffers, and set ‌explicit triggers for capital ‍raises or deleveraging. The overarching ⁣lesson: align financing tenor ⁢and covenants ‍with the long-duration thesis​ for the asset rather than‍ treating bitcoin⁢ as a short-term ​trading ​book.

Volatility controls demand⁣ operational‍ rigor. ⁣Firms converting​ corporate​ cash into ⁤highly volatile digital ⁣assets ​benefit from formal⁢ controls that‌ go‍ beyond mantra-driven‌ HODLing. Practical measures include:

  • Structured accumulation (dollar-cost ⁢averaging and ⁢tranche purchases‍ to reduce entry-timing risk).
  • Governance ‍gates (board-approved allocation limits and sign-off thresholds for⁤ incremental purchases or sales).
  • Hedging playbooks ‌ (when appropriate, calibrated option overlays or short-term collars to manage extreme drawdowns).
  • Operational safeguards (multi-sig ‍custody, ⁢third-party audits, and periodic​ red-team reconciliation).

These measures convert​ price turbulence into ⁣manageable operational decisions ⁤and‌ create repeatable‌ rules that ​remove⁣ emotion from ‌large treasury moves.

Transparent disclosure‌ builds market credibility. Public⁤ companies ‌that pivot into new asset classes must​ disclose holdings, cost basis, custodial​ arrangements and ⁤funding mechanics with clarity and⁣ cadence. A concise reporting framework⁤ reduces investor uncertainty and ​mitigates litigation and market⁤ rumor risk. example disclosure ⁢elements are summarized below:

Practical Recommendations ‍for Corporations and⁤ Investors Seeking Direct Bitcoin Exposure

Corporations should⁤ treat bitcoin allocations⁣ as ⁣strategic, not⁢ speculative: set a clear⁢ mandate that links holdings to balance-sheet objectives and stress-tested scenarios. ‌Establish a formal approval​ chain and written⁢ policy covering ‌target allocation ranges, rebalancing ⁣triggers,​ and reporting cadence.Governance must name⁣ accountable⁤ officers and ⁤independent oversight, ‌and⁢ legal teams should vet custodial agreements and securities⁢ classification before any purchase.

Operational ‌execution demands institutional-grade custody, insurance ⁣and liquidity planning. Use a‌ mix ​of qualified‍ custodians, multi-signature solutions and insured ⁢cold storage to mitigate counterparty⁢ and ‌cyber⁢ risk.Maintain ⁢a ⁤liquidity ‍buffer in fiat or short-duration‍ assets to avoid forced ​selling‌ during drawdowns,and coordinate tax,accounting and disclosure teams ‍to‍ ensure transparent external reporting.Consider staged purchases ​using ‌dollar-cost averaging‌ or ‍derivative overlays to manage execution⁤ risk while ​preserving upside exposure.
